Barn roof replacement services involve removing an existing roof structure and installing a new roofing system on a property’s barn or similar outbuilding. This process typically includes assessing the current roof’s condition, removing damaged or outdated materials, and installing new roofing materials that suit the structure’s needs. The goal is to provide a durable, weather-resistant cover that protects stored equipment, livestock, or supplies from the elements. Professionals experienced in barn roof replacement can ensure the new roof is properly installed to withstand local weather conditions and extend the lifespan of the building.
This service helps address common problems such as leaks, extensive wear, or structural damage that can compromise the integrity of a barn’s roof. Over time, exposure to rain, snow, wind, and sun can lead to issues like missing shingles, rotting wood, or rusted metal components. Replacing the roof can prevent further deterioration, reduce the risk of water damage, and improve the overall safety of the structure. Barn roof replacement can also enhance energy efficiency and reduce maintenance needs by upgrading to modern, resilient roofing materials.
Properties that typically utilize barn roof replacement services include agricultural buildings, equestrian facilities, storage sheds, and other rural or semi-rural structures. These buildings often have large roof spans and require specialized installation techniques to ensure stability and weather resistance. Commercial or industrial properties with similar large roof areas may also seek replacement services to maintain their operational integrity. The choice of roofing materials may vary based on the property’s use, budget, and aesthetic preferences, with options including metal, asphalt, rubber, or wood shingles.

Cost Range for Materials - The expense of roofing materials for barn roof replacement typically varies from $3 to $8 per square foot, depending on the type of material selected. For example, asphalt shingles may cost around $3 per square foot, while metal roofing can be closer to $8 per square foot.
Labor Costs - Labor charges for barn roof replacement generally range between $1,000 and $3,500, based on the size and complexity of the project. Larger or more intricate roofs tend to incur higher labor costs due to increased time and effort.
Total Project Expenses - Overall costs for replacing a barn roof can span from approximately $2,500 to over $10,000. This range accounts for material choices, roof size, and local labor rates in Beaverton, OR and nearby areas.
Additional Factors - Costs may increase if structural repairs or insulation are needed, with extra charges potentially adding $500 to $2,000. Contact local service providers for detailed estimates tailored to specific barn sizes and conditions.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s that a barn roof needs replacement? Visible damage such as missing shingles, leaks, sagging areas, and significant wear are indicators that a roof may require replacement.
How long does a barn roof replacement typically take? The duration varies depending on the size and complexity of the project, but most replacements are completed within a few days.
What materials are used for barn roof replacements? Local contractors often recommend materials like metal, asphalt shingles, or wood shakes, based on the barn’s structure and your preferences.
Is it necessary to replace the entire roof if only part of it is damaged? In some cases, partial repairs may suffice, but extensive damage often requires a full roof replacement for long-term durability.
